Output e4cfc7449411fc5a7eba2a549404ba1d73e0addd664e002d8fc74bea2dd9ab15:21

value
140349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b67b8e44faae6a852c18b8a2a09b304a1fe3b7 OP_EQUAL
address
3LSj3z62astv31UpjQo72TrXmk7tFxPxjy
transaction
e4cfc7449411fc5a7eba2a549404ba1d73e0addd664e002d8fc74bea2dd9ab15
confirmations
283800
spent
true